  15. White Engine started life on PS3 when Kitase/Nomura decided the PS2 wasn't enough for them anymore. Square's looking to make a good part of it platform-agnostic (named Crystal Tools), altho optimizations will have to be done later on for each system because they can't fully convert everything. The most advanced version of the engine right now runs on PS3 hardware (well, the PC+devkits workshops thingamajigs they have set obviously), and I'd be willing to bet the 360/Wii/N-Gage/penis iterations haven't even reached a proper, stable status. Much less v1.0. The Versus team has been doing a lot of improvement on the PS3 specific side of things too, as they were intending to have their game running on a better version of the engine than FFXIII's. This has most certainly carried over to the latter's coding. Case in point: UE3 was specifically designed from the beginning to work fully on next gen systems, yet you'd be hard pressed to find a UE3 game that (technically) fares better than Gears of War. Because that game was tailored to a very specific platform and that heavily affected the development of the engine, in terms of programming and game design.
